What does an 'End School Zone' sign indicate?

: Understanding the Sign's Purpose

An 'End School Zone' sign indicates that the special traffic regulations and reduced speed limits that were in effect during school hours are now ending. This means drivers can return to the standard posted speed limit for that road section.

Step 3:
: Typical Characteristics

- The sign typically appears after a school zone section - It signals the conclusion of reduced speed restrictions - Drivers should resume normal driving speed - The sign helps transition drivers back to standard road rules

: Safety Implications

- Even after the sign, drivers should remain cautious - Children might still be present near schools - Continued vigilance is recommended, especially during school arrival and dismissal times

Final Answer

An 'End School Zone' sign indicates the conclusion of special school zone traffic restrictions, signaling drivers to return to the standard posted speed limit while maintaining awareness of potential pedestrian activity.
